None of India’s major telecom companies have authorized such offers. Airtel, Jio, VI, and BSNL have all clarified on their official portals that these messages are fake . Legitimate recharge offers are announced exclusively through official apps, verified social media accounts, and authorized retail channels—never through random viral links.
